1. Lack of Clear Communication with Your eCommerce Outsourcing Partner
Clear communication is very important for any successful outsourcing relationship. Miscommunication can lead to inconsistent service quality, which can harm your brand reputation. For example, 45% of customers get frustrated when their issues are not resolved because of poor communication.
- Have Regular Meetings: Schedule weekly or bi-weekly meetings to make sure everyone is on the same page and to talk about any ongoing issues.
- Use Shared Tools: Use tools like Slack or Trello to make sure everyone is communicating in real time.
- Create a Communication Plan: Make a detailed plan that explains how and when communication will happen.
By focusing on communication, you can make sure your eCommerce customer support outsourcing partner understands your brand’s voice and values.

2. Not Defining Key Performance Indicators (KPIs)
KPIs are important for measuring the success of your outsourcing partnership. Without clear metrics, it’s hard to know if your efforts to outsource eCommerce customer service are working as expected.
- Response Time: Aim for an average response time of under 2 minutes for live chat and 24 hours for emails.
- Resolution Rate: Make sure 85% of customer issues are solved on the first contact.
- Customer Satisfaction (CSAT): Try to get a CSAT score of 90% or higher.
Studies show that businesses with well-defined KPIs see a 25% improvement in customer satisfaction.

3. Choosing the Wrong eCommerce Outsourcing Services Company
Choosing the right partner is very important for the success of your outsourcing strategy. A partner with the wrong expertise or cultural fit can lead to poor service quality.
- Check Industry Experience: Look for companies that have experience in your specific area. For example, 60% of businesses that outsource to industry-specific partners are more satisfied.
- Review Case Studies: Ask for case studies or testimonials to see how well they perform.
- Check Cultural Fit: Make sure the partner understands your brand’s values and what your customers expect.
If the partner isn’t a good match, customer satisfaction can drop by 40%, so choose wisely.

6. Poor Integration with Existing Systems
Smooth integration of systems is important for efficient operations. Poor integration can lead to delays and errors in service delivery.
- Use Compatible Systems: Make sure the outsourcing partner’s technology works well with your existing tools.
- Test Thoroughly: Do trials to find and fix any integration issues.
- Provide Access: Give the partner access to necessary systems like CRM or inventory management.
Smooth integration can reduce operational errors by 35%, improving overall efficiency.

7. Inadequate Data Security Measures
Data security is very important when outsourcing customer service. A data breach can damage your reputation and lead to financial losses.
- Check Certifications: Make sure the partner follows regulations like GDPR or CCPA.
- Use Encrypted Systems: Protect customer data with strong security measures.
- Regular Audits: Conduct periodic checks to ensure compliance.
A recent report showed that 55% of businesses that outsourced without proper security measures faced data breaches.

9. Overlooking Contractual Obligations
A clear contract is important to protect your interests and avoid hidden costs.
- Include SLAs: Define service-level agreements for response times, resolution rates, and more.
- Termination Clauses: Outline terms for ending the partnership if expectations are not met.
- Payment Terms: Make sure pricing and billing are transparent.
A well-drafted contract can save businesses from 30% of potential disputes.
